create a crashed client on burp-ui demo

Hello Benjamin,

Is it possible for you to create a fake client demo and try to backup and cancel it then, steps:

  1. copy burp.conf client file of existing one to burp_fake.conf
  2. Rename cname and certs files to ensure client is different to previous one, but keep same selections.
  3. execute burp -c burp_fake.conf -a b wait to phase2 to start and break the client Ctr+C.

That's it, don't setup cron and never finish it.

It could help me to test: https://github.com/pablodav/burp_server_reports/issues/19 And know if it is really working.

The idea is: burp-reports will detect a client in non idle state -> then will try to get backup report to later look at totsize of backup -> if backup is 0 it will be marked as state: never.
